The deployer of the stablecoin contract can mint unlimited tokens before the ownership is transferred to DSCEngine.
In deployment, the stablecoin token contract is deployed first. The deployer acts as the owner of the stablecoin until the DSCEngine contract is deployed and the ownership is transferred to it.
Until then the deployer can mint unlimited tokens.
The deployer can gain a lot of tokens without putting up any collateral. If people are unaware of this, they might put up collateral for receiving the token in which case they will be at a loss.
Manual Review
Being clear in the documentation about this power of the deployer or change the pattern to launch the token contract from the engine contract itself.
The contest is live. Earn rewards by submitting a finding.
This is your time to appeal against judgements on your submissions.
Appeals are being carefully reviewed by our judges.